PDB entry 7d1i

View 7d1i on RCSB PDB site
Description: crystal structure of acinetobacter baumannii murg
Deposited on 2020-09-14, released 2021-07-14
The last revision was dated 2021-07-14, with a file datestamp of 2021-07-09.
Experiment type: XRAY
Resolution: 3.49 Å
R-factor: N/A
AEROSPACI score: 0.13 (click here for full SPACI score report)

Chains and heterogens:

  • Chain 'A':
    Compound: UDP-N-acetylglucosamine--N-acetylmuramyl-(pentapeptide) pyrophosphoryl-undecaprenol N-acetylglucosamine transferase
    Species: ACINETOBACTER BAUMANNII [TaxId:470]
    Gene: murG, BGC29_11725
